I am creating a subclass, which has Limited Use for multiple different actions. All these actions should share the same Limited Use pool. The fighters Superiority Dice would be similar, but it seems this one does not add actions either. Is it even possible to do that?

You would make one action to track the reset type and the limited uses. Then each of the other actions would each be programmed as part of its own Class Feature Option. They will have no limited use data at all, and only track the information for the specific actions. Because everyone I’ll be part of the same parent feature, they will all stay interrelated.

So far so good, but how can I make the second feature use the tracking of the first? I can not find any options like that would allow that. Do the players have to track the progress by themself?
Don’t make them as two features. Make them all as 1 feature.
Parent Feature:
”Tracking Action”
“Ability Actions 1-3“
Yes, they will have to track things themselves, but by having everything as part of a single class feature it will make that much easier. If everything is part of the same feature, whenever the player taps the Chosen “Ability Action,” a sidebar will slide out for them. Since the “Tracking Action” is attached to the same class feature, the counters it generates will also be listed directly on that sidebar for them to tick off right there for their convenience.
